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03586560320 88711 4758347
8882609525 54934
8882609525 54934
35340198255 228 7001
All about undefined
Interested in learning more?
8882609525 54934
35340198255 228 7001
See more
136301766 88
155 46337884342 504531 94065
See more
6901151640 31018986
9451768540 264 444
See more